Transaction 33e9673f90633636d80b09f34b493e27cf6f2d028aecc0c58b48ff6ca667bb68
1 Input
2 Outputs
- 33e9673f90633636d80b09f34b493e27cf6f2d028aecc0c58b48ff6ca667bb68:0
- 33e9673f90633636d80b09f34b493e27cf6f2d028aecc0c58b48ff6ca667bb68:1
value 23300000
address 3FTxHVDXa3Zzowq3MM2kymb9FeniMSLE4v
value 4832125362
address 1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x